Nairobi, December 31 (Darfur24)

Chadian security forces have arrested eight members of the Rapid Support Forces (RSF) in the Chadian border city of Tine after they entered Chadian territory under unclear circumstances.

Sources told Darfur24 that Chadian authorities detained the eight armed men after they crossed the border in a combat vehicle.

According to the sources, the soldiers became lost in the desert and were separated from their unit before inadvertently crossing into Chadian territory while attempting to find their way.

The sources added that Chadian authorities have launched investigations into the incident and are preparing to transfer the detainees to the city of Amdjarass to complete legal and administrative procedures ahead of their deportation.
